Video: Brad Keselowski Loses Control Entering Turn 1, Collects Team Penske Teammate Joey Logano

 

Sunday Afternoon’s Go Bowling at The Glen for the NASCAR Cup Series at Watkins Glen has not been nice to Team Penske thus far, and the trend is seemingly going to continue, as Brad Keselowski lost control of his No. 2 Wabash National Ford Mustang entering turn one – for at least the third time today — spinning directly into Joey Logano’s No. 22 Verizon 5G Ford Mustang.

The incident didn’t draw a caution flag, but forced both drivers to make their pitstops a little early than they had hoped, in order to assess and repair the damage on their Ford Mustang’s. After pitting, Keselowski would be scored 36th, one lap down, while Logano would stay on the lead lap in 33rd.
